Personally, I loved all of the rustic charm and decorations! I love all the wood accents! It was definitely an experience. Alice, the cat, is fiesty and vocal, but we loved her! She was the best part of the whole stay. Layla, the dog, led us on the tour around the property. We were inspired to sing the Layla song with her there. There was a 3 day old baby goat I got to hold! The shower felt amazing after a long day of exploring. My husband loved the detailed, antique chess set. No one else used the hot tub at night, so we relaxed and saw stars for miles. Darcy and Gina were fun to talk to at breakfast. I know it is a working farm, so Gina is very busy. When she gets a chance to sit and chat, she does. Darcy makes amazing caramel macchiatos! If you love word puzzles, that is Gina’s jam! She will team up with you in the daily NY Times word puzzle.
